Juni 2015 · While it’s true that the primary chord in “I Know You Rider” is D, and the song is said to be in the key of D overall, the notes and chords are not actually drawn from the D major scale. Instead, they are drawn from the G major scale, but centered on the 5th degree, D, making what’s called D Mixolydian mode. In this mode, the notes are ...
